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/typo3/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Google maps Google map api密钥对于生成的域无效?_Google Maps - Fatal编程技术网

Google maps Google map api密钥对于生成的域无效?

Google maps Google map api密钥对于生成的域无效?,google-maps,Google Maps,昨天我第一次尝试谷歌地图API,我正在为我的一个公共域生成API密钥。也许我犯了一个错误,因为我在本地主机上测试了这个密钥,这很好,但是当我试图在我的网站上发布这个密钥时,我得到了javascript警报,它说我的API密钥对该域无效,但我正在为该域生成该密钥。诀窍是什么?出于测试目的,密钥始终适用于本地主机。但在其他域上,域必须与域匹配,您已向注册了密钥。那么,如果真的匹配,你控制了吗?在您注册密钥的域中没有输入错误?还是使用子域?另一个问题可能是,Google希望您的应用程序(使用地图)可以

昨天我第一次尝试谷歌地图API,我正在为我的一个公共域生成API密钥。也许我犯了一个错误,因为我在本地主机上测试了这个密钥,这很好,但是当我试图在我的网站上发布这个密钥时,我得到了javascript警报,它说我的API密钥对该域无效,但我正在为该域生成该密钥。诀窍是什么?

出于测试目的,密钥始终适用于本地主机。但在其他域上,域必须与域匹配,您已向注册了密钥。那么,如果真的匹配,你控制了吗?在您注册密钥的域中没有输入错误?还是使用子域?另一个问题可能是,Google希望您的应用程序(使用地图)可以从web访问,而不需要密码或类似的障碍。

出于测试目的,密钥始终适用于localhost。但在其他域上,域必须与域匹配,您已向注册了密钥。那么,如果真的匹配,你控制了吗?在您注册密钥的域中没有输入错误?还是使用子域?另一个问题可能是,谷歌希望你的应用程序(使用地图)可以从网络上访问,而不需要密码或类似的障碍。

每个域都必须有自己的密钥。您确定为每个域(即域+本地主机)使用了适当的密钥吗?我对本地主机和域使用相同的密钥。在本地主机上它可以工作,但在域上不是这样。我从谷歌那里得到了这个密钥,用于域而不是本地主机,所以mu questin就是为什么它在域上不起作用的原因,如果它是为域生成的,傻瓜:))请记住,谷歌说密钥始终适用于本地主机,但与密钥注册的域有关。听起来好像没有为该域生成此密钥。每个域都必须有自己的密钥。您确定为每个域(即域+本地主机)使用了适当的密钥吗?我对本地主机和域使用相同的密钥。在本地主机上它可以工作,但在域上不是这样。我从谷歌那里得到了这个密钥,用于域而不是本地主机,所以mu questin就是为什么它在域上不起作用的原因,如果它是为域生成的,傻瓜:))请记住,谷歌说密钥始终适用于本地主机,但与密钥注册的域有关。听起来这个密钥不是为那个域生成的。